Description
I have been considering these as a supplement to the inside keyword, by having it Work in a way similar to outer_keyword. That is instead of specifying in which "subtree" The region of interest lies, to specify how deeply nested it actually is. For example
function(something(nice(check(data))))inner 1 argument 1 should select
nice(check(data))inner 2 argument 1 should select
check(data)etc... if a plain inner is used, then the behavior should be to select the innermost one.
Nonetheless, these can be Not trivial In how tie-breaking and adjective_decoding should take place
